An emerging leader in the Pipeline & Utilities Inspection industry, C&L prides itself on the depth of industry knowledge, expertise of our professional personnel and consistent focus on delivering exceptional Client service. C and L Inspection (C&L), a privately-held company headquartered in Dallas, Texas founded in 2013, has quickly garnered reputation in providing premium personnel in the niche industry of Pipeline & Utilities Inspection.

    Job Title: Sr. Electrical Inspector Location: Larose, LA Duration: 04/12/2024-10/30/2024   Job Description:   Responsibilities of the Sr. Electrical Inspector shall be to assure that the Electrical, Communication, and Instrumentation installation on construction projects is performed in accordance with the Company’s drawings, plans, specifications, and the Contract Documents.   Duties may include, but are not limited to:   ·      The Sr. Electrical Inspector must have a thorough working knowledge of the electrical, communication, and instrumentation systems for natural gas pipeline or industrial facilities ·      This includes having a basic working knowledge of data acquisition systems and pneumatic and electrical control systems ·      This inspector shall also have a working knowledge of the current accepted edition of the National Electric Code (ANSI/NFPA 70) under the Code of Regulations Title 49 Part 192 and its provisions. ·      Being familiar with the approved for construction drawings and the Company specifications. ·      Completing and submitting applicable inspection reports that accurately describe the work performed on the project ·      The ability to read and interpret piping and instrumentation drawings pertaining to the construction project. ·      Follow control logic in project electrical drawings and interface with existing systems. ·      Be familiar with interpretation of hazardous locations as defined by the N.E.C. and Company specifications and be knowledgeable of approved wiring methods for these areas ·      Able to perform or supervise the loop checks of electrical construction and document information. ·      Be familiar with the A/C power systems including single phase and three phase systems and proper wiring methods. ·      Understand interfacing of pneumatic and electrical control systems (i.e. actuators, pressure, and I/P transmitters)   Requirements:   ·      Familiar with National Electric Code (N.E.C.) guidelines ·      Trade Certificate ·      10 years experience ·      5 years supervisor experience ·      OSHA 10 or OSHA 30 #electricalinspector #oilandgas #pipelineinspection

    Job Title: Sr. Welding Inspector (Dual Cert) Location: Blessing, TX Duration: 04/05/2024-10/31/2024   Job Description:   ·      The Sr. Welding Inspector must ensure proper welding and radiographic procedures are qualified and utilized, radiographers are certified, welders are qualified, sound welds are produced, and proper documentation is maintained.   Duties may include, but are not limited to:   ·      Plan and organize inspection duties in advance. ·      Assure any design changes or material substitutions are discussed with the Chief Inspection and proper Company approval is obtained. ·      Assure the radiographer’s certification is complete and correct, that acceptable radiographic procedures are established, the technician(s) has a copy of the Company specifications, current API-1104 edition, and the technician is familiar with Company procedures for film identification, form completion, documentation for the disposition of rejects, etc. It is not the Sr. Welding Inspector’s responsibility to interpret the radiographic film; however, the Inspector should be knowledgeable in film interpretation. ·      Be familiar with the approved construction drawings and Company specifications. ·      Understanding the Contract document as it relates to his or her duties on the project ·      Completing and submitting applicable inspection reports that accurately describe the work performed on the project ·      Assure any design changes or material substitutions are discussed with the Chief Inspection and proper Company approval is obtained. ·      Verify all materials used in the installation are in compliance with Company requirements. ·      Assure a welding procedure is established ·      Assure the correct WPS being utilized is reviewed prior to the start of welding ·      Assure that each welder is qualified for the work he is performing ·      Observe the x-ray procedure (including developing and handling) being used to assure it is appropriate for the applications and this procedure is producing acceptable radiographs. ·      Assure the Radiographer’s certifications are current and in accordance with SNC-TC-1A. ·      Continuously observe the welding technique and radiographic procedure to assure proper procedures are being followed. ·      Monitor the quality of the welds being made to assure sound welds are being made at all joints. ·      Assure the repairs made to correct defects in a pipe weld sufficiently corrected the defect and the weld satisfies the requirements as outlined by the appropriate codes and Company specifications. ·      Assure proper documentation is maintained by the radiographic crew including the disposition of each reject.   Requirements:   ·      API 1169 ·      OSHA 10 or OSHA 30 ·      CWI/CPWI-V/CWB ·      NACE 1 or 2 ·      10 years hands on experience ·      5 years supervisor experience #oilandgas #weldinginspector #pipelineinspection
